From 44d6680d30d98ef77ccd3203909d5e7d8547d63a Mon Sep 17 00:00:00 2001 From: Laurent Bercot Date: Thu, 27 Jun 2024 14:47:37 +0000 Subject: Delete unused resattr.c in config Signed-off-by: Laurent Bercot --- src/config/resattr.c | 56 ---------------------------------------------------- 1 file changed, 56 deletions(-) delete mode 100644 src/config/resattr.c diff --git a/src/config/resattr.c b/src/config/resattr.c deleted file mode 100644 index 80bd0e0..0000000 --- a/src/config/resattr.c +++ /dev/null @@ -1,56 +0,0 @@ -/* ISC license. */ - -#include -#include -#include - -#include "tipidee-config-internal.h" - -static repo resattr = \ -{ \ - .ga = GENALLOC_ZERO, \ - .tree = AVLTREE_INIT(8, 3, 8, &node_dtok, &node_cmp, &resattr.ga), \ - .storage = &g.storage \ -} ; - -void confnode_start (node *node, char const *key, size_t filepos, uint32_t line) -{ - return node_start(&g.storage, node, key, filepos, line) ; -} - -void confnode_add (node *node, char const *s, size_t len) -{ - return node_add(&g.storage, node, s, len) ; -} - -node const *conftree_search (char const *key) -{ - return repo_search(&conftree, key) ; -} - -void conftree_add (node const *node) -{ - return repo_add(&conftree, node) ; -} - -void conftree_update (node const *node) -{ - return repo_update(&conftree, node) ; -} - -static int confnode_write (uint32_t d, unsigned int h, void *data) -{ - node *nod = genalloc_s(node, &conftree.ga) + d ; - (void)h ; - if ((conftree.storage->s[nod->key] & ~0x20) == 'A') - { - conftree.storage->s[++nod->data] |= '@' ; - nod->datalen-- ; - } - return cdbmake_add((cdbmaker *)data, conftree.storage->s + nod->key, nod->keylen, conftree.storage->s + nod->data, nod->datalen) ; -} - -int conftree_write (cdbmaker *cm) -{ - return avltree_iter(&conftree.tree, &confnode_write, cm) ; -} -- cgit v1.2.3